Collection: Everything
-
Hot Cross Buns
Regular price From £3.50 GBPRegular priceUnit price / per -
London Neighbourhoods Sweatshirt
Regular price £35.00 GBPRegular priceUnit price / per -
Lake District Print
Regular price From £6.00 GBPRegular priceUnit price / per -
Museums of London Print
Regular price From £6.00 GBPRegular priceUnit price / per -
London Coffee Shops Card
Regular price From £3.50 GBPRegular priceUnit price / per -
London in Autumn Print
Regular price From £6.00 GBPRegular priceUnit price / per -
London Markets
Regular price From £6.00 GBPRegular priceUnit price / per -
Peace on Earth Nativity Card
Regular price From £3.50 GBPRegular priceUnit price / per -
Merry Christmas Jolly Guards
Regular price From £3.50 GBPRegular priceUnit price / per -
Mince Pie Christmas Card
Regular price From £3.50 GBPRegular priceUnit price / per -
Mayfair Print
Regular price From £6.00 GBPRegular priceUnit price / per -
North West London Print
Regular price From £6.00 GBPRegular priceUnit price / per -
Primrose Hill Greeting Card
Regular price From £3.50 GBPRegular priceUnit price / per -
Regent's Canal Walk Card
Regular price From £3.50 GBPRegular priceUnit price / per -
Royal London Print
Regular price From £6.00 GBPRegular priceUnit price / per -
Spitalfields & Shoreditch Card
Regular price From £3.50 GBPRegular priceUnit price / per -
London South Bank Card
Regular price From £3.50 GBPRegular priceUnit price / per -
Scandi London Print
Regular price From £6.00 GBPRegular priceUnit price / per -
Bakeries of London Print
Regular price From £6.00 GBPRegular priceUnit price / per -
London Theatres Print
Regular price From £6.00 GBPRegular priceUnit price / per -
Windsor Card
Regular price From £3.50 GBPRegular priceUnit price / per -
Bloomsbury Card
Regular price From £3.50 GBPRegular priceUnit price / per -
The City (of London) Card
Regular price From £3.50 GBPRegular priceUnit price / per -
The City (of London)
Regular price From £6.00 GBPRegular priceUnit price / per